“The History of Jefferson County, Wisconsin”, published: Chicago: Western Historical Company. 1879. THOMAS HUTCHENS, farmer, Sec. 14; P. O. Fort Atkinson; born in Ontario, Co., N.Y., Feb. 14, 1830; son of John and Catherine, nee Wagger; came to Wisconsin and located at Fort Atkinson in 1856; and commenced working at his trade of shoemaking, remaining four years, then moved to Section 15 and commenced farming. In 1872, purchased eighty acres of Section 14, which now forms his homestead. He married, December 16, 1858, Miss Sylvia A. West, daughter of F. West, of Fort Atkinson; have four children – Lovell W., Maude M., Francis E., William H. Elected Clerk of District School Board one term. Member of the I.O.O.F. and Farmers’ Union Association; attends the Methodist Church; Republican. Submitted by: Linda Pingel (LPingel@worldnet.att.net)
